I think I've found the answer: it cannot be stopped *api->ProcessPages*.
I have tried the following code:
api->SetPageSegMode(tesseract::PSM_AUTO);
Pix* image = pixRead(CStringA(sSrcFile));
api->SetImage(image);
ETEXT_DESC monitor;
monitor.cancel = &CMyDocEx::cancel;
api->Recognize(&monitor);
pixDestroy(&image);
With the following cancel method:
static bool cancel(void* cancel_this, int words)
{
return m_bCancelFlag;
}
Of course, I setup *m_bCancelFlag* at my Escape key (or whatever). And it
stops properly *api->SetImage*, on demand. But this is not the case for
*api->ProcessPages*. Is there a missing feature here ?
